Output 90e2342d87a94666c3eb16c91717989a0dbcd1e089a3f3656fdcd32d2089e501:0

value
1520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be664a0a7b2586e01bd2cf61ec00d524d0c4025c OP_EQUAL
address
3K3krAtXLDbPuk2LRw5tqpCuFisegsmxXN
transaction
90e2342d87a94666c3eb16c91717989a0dbcd1e089a3f3656fdcd32d2089e501
spent
true